Wineries in Maharashtra, which produce over 90 per cent of the wine in the country, have been facing a severe financial crunch due to economic recession. The problem was compounded because of the terrorist attacks of November 26, 2008 in Mumbai, as the foreign tourist inflow -- on which the retail wine business is heavily dependent -- was badly hit.
